It should be noted it is the Structure Proprietor who is legally reliant the Adjoining Owner for damage not the Check out this site Contractor who remains in legal terms simply an employee of the Structure Owner. Once assigned land surveyors can not be rejected or changed neither can they take out unless they are considered or regard themselves incapable of executing their responsibilities. There are minimal needs for the notice to be legitimate and there are a number of kinds of notification depending upon the sort of proposed job. A celebration wall surface contract must include information on how the structure jobs will be performed, including appropriate functioning hours, just how the celebration wall surface will be accessed and any type of various other required arrangements relating to the work [3] The land surveyor (or property surveyors) will certainly draft an Event Wall Honor, a lawfully binding record that specifies the work to be done, the timeline, and how expenses will certainly be divided. Commonly, not simply one side alone owns event wall surfaces-- both the proprietors of the adjacent buildings have it. Most of the times, each proprietor has equal civil liberties and obligations over the wall surface. That suggests both are anticipated to maintain it, stay clear of harming it, and respect the various other's use it. A structure proprietor shall not exercise his legal rights in a way that may create unnecessary hassle to an adjoining proprietor [4] In case of damages to the Adjoining Proprietors' residential or commercial property the Structure Owner need to immediately make great any damage or make up the Adjoining Proprietor. Under Civil Procedure Rules Component 35, an experienced witness land surveyor acting in lawsuits owes their primary duty to the court, not to the celebration who advised them. Nevertheless with those agreements are in some cases vague and can miss out on concerns as the two Proprietors unless experienced in structure issues are not knowledgeable about all the implications of the job. Those arrangements can still be contested later causing court activities, whereas Event wall honors if correctly prepared are much less likely to be tested.
